Definitions related to stomach neoplasms:
-
(gastric neoplasm) A benign or malignant neoplasm involving the stomach.NCI ThesaurusU.S. National Cancer Institute, 2021
-
New abnormal gastric tissue that grows by excessive cellular division and proliferation more rapidly than normal and continues to grow after the stimuli that initiated the new growth cease.CRISP ThesaurusNational Institutes of Health, 2006
-
Tumors or cancer of the STOMACH.NLM Medical Subject HeadingsU.S. National Library of Medicine, 2021
-
(neoplasm of the stomach) A tumor (abnormal growth of tissue) of the stomach.Human Phenotype Ontology (HPO)The Human Phenotype Ontology Project, 2021
